Mixing Console - Editing the Volume and Tonal Balance - To select the target parts: Press the [MIXING CONSOLE] button repeatedly to call up the display for the following parts in sequence. • PANEL PART Use this display when you want to adjust the balance between the entire Song part, entire Style part, Mic part, Right 1 part, Right 2 part and Left part. • STYLE PART Use this display when you want to adjust the balance between all parts of the Style. • SONG CH 1 - 8 or SONG CH 9 - 16 Use this display when you want to adjust the balance between all parts of the Song. Pressing the [A] (PART) button will alternates the display between SONG CH 1 - 8 and SONG CH 9 - 16. NOTE The Style/Song part components are the same as those that appear in the display when you press the panel [CHANNEL ON/ OFF] button once or twice. To call up the desired display Press the TAB [-][3] buttons to select the desired display from the following items. For details about each display Page, refer to the Reference Manual on the website. 3 10 • VOL/VOICE Changes the Voice for each part and adjusts panning and volume for each part. • FILTER Adjusts the Harmonic Content (resonance) and sound brightness. • TUNE Pitch-related settings (tuning, transpose, etc.). • EFFECT Selects the effect type and adjusts the effect depth for each part (page 102).
